WWE’s live Super SmackDown show on Tuesday night did a 2.00 (2.0) cable rating, which is up from the previous three Friday taped episodes, but down from the last live SmackDown special on August 30 that got a 2.11 rating.
It averaged 3.05 million viewers, again, just above the Friday night range, but below that of the last special. Among the teen male demographic ages 12-17, the show was about even.
SmackDown was #13 in overall viewers and was beat out by ESPN’s Ohio St. vs. Duke college basketball game, A&E’s Storage Wars, and Sons of Anarchy on FX.
